ORA-53021: cannot insert a rule or macro string that was already inserted ORACLE 报错 故障修复 远程处理

文档解释

ORA-53021: cannot insert a rule or macro string that was already inserted

Cause: The rules or macros existed in the repository.

Action: Insert a new rule or macro.

这是ORACLE报出的一个错误,表示无法插入已经存在的规则或宏字符串。

官方解释

常见案例

一般处理方法及步骤

1.检查DLL文件,确认该规则或宏字符串是否存在。

2.如果是,可以通过DL_DELETE_RULE函数删除该规则或宏字符串,以便可以重新插入。

3.也可以使用DL_GET_RULE函数检查规则是否已经存在,然后再根据情况采取相应措施。


数据运维技术 » ORA-53021: cannot insert a rule or macro string that was already inserted ORACLE 报错 故障修复 远程处理